ClickPlay Films video production NYC: Winning Tactics for B2B Campaigns
Discover the Benefits of Specialist Video Clip Production for Your Company RequirementsWhen it pertains to promoting your organization, leveraging professional video clip production can make a significant distinction. You'll discover that high quality video clips boost your brand narration and produce much deeper emotional connections with your aud